How they compare
Gabon currently reports 116.7% against 90.5% in Botswana, a difference of 26.2%.
That makes Gabon's figure about 1.3 times Botswana's.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 23 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Botswana ahead.
Botswana ranks 13th and Gabon ranks 11th of 142 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Botswana averaged higher in 1 and Gabon in 2.
